We will do a lollipop route through this section of Cougar Mountain that will take us to the Fantastic Erratic, before completing the loop back to our cars.
Our route will be: counter clockwise on the Harvey Manning Trail to Cougar Pass Trail, to W Tibbetts Creek Trail, out and back to Fantastic Erratic on the Bear Ridge Trail, to Shangri-La trail, to No Name trail, Surprise Creek Trail, and Shangri-La trail again back to our cars. We can also check out the Million Dollar viewpoint by the parking lot on our way out if visibility is good.

Required Equipment
Ten Essential Systems
- Navigation (map & compass)
- Sun protection (sunglasses & sunscreen)
- Insulation (extra clothing)
- Illumination (headlamp/flashlight)
- First-aid supplies
- Fire (waterproof matches/lighter/candle)
- Repair kit and tools
- Nutrition (extra food)
- Hydration (extra water)
- Emergency shelter (tent/plastic tube tent/garbage bag)
